  • Title

    Design of a new controller based on D-S evidential theory

  • Abstract
    The single-input and single-output loop controller using only one sensor is widely applied in the industrial control field. As it is difficult to obtain the precise response of the control using only one sensor, the result cannot satisfy the demand. In the multi-sensors system, one must solve the problem of fusing different uncertainty data. This paper discusses a new design method for the controller in the light of Dempster-Shafer (D-S) evidential theory, and presents an algorithm to define the basic probability assignment by using fuzzy control. Finally, the new controller was applied to the chemical dosage control system in the water treatment industry.
